随着技术的不断发展,React作为前端开发框架的领导者,其版本更新也愈发频繁。每一次的版本更新都可能带来新的特性和改进,同时也可能引入新的挑战。对于开发者来说,如何从React升级版本并优化用户体验,成为了一个重要的课题。本文将为您详细介绍从React升级版本到优化用户体验的全攻略,帮助您轻松应对新版本挑战,提升用户满意度与操作流畅度。
一、了解React新版本特性
在开始升级React版本之前,首先需要了解新版本的特性和变化。以下是一些常见的React新版本特性:
- 性能优化:新版本通常会引入一些性能优化,例如更快的渲染速度、更少的内存占用等。
- API更新:新版本可能会更新或删除一些API,需要开发者根据文档进行相应的调整。
- 新特性:新版本可能会引入一些新的特性和功能,例如新的组件、新的生命周期方法等。
二、制定升级计划
在了解新版本特性后,接下来需要制定一个合理的升级计划。以下是一些建议:
- 评估现有项目:了解项目中使用的技术栈和依赖关系,确保所有依赖库都支持新版本。
- 备份项目:在升级之前,备份现有项目,以防升级过程中出现问题。
- 分阶段升级:可以将项目分为多个阶段进行升级,例如先升级React,再升级其他依赖库。
三、升级React版本
以下是升级React版本的步骤:
- 安装新版本:使用npm或yarn安装新版本的React。
或npm install react@versionyarn add react@version - 更新代码:根据新版本的API更新代码,修复兼容性问题。
- 测试:在本地和线上环境进行充分测试,确保升级后的项目运行正常。
四、优化用户体验
在升级React版本后,以下是一些优化用户体验的方法:
- 性能优化:使用React的性能优化技巧,例如使用
React.memo、useCallback、useMemo等。 - 响应式设计:确保项目在不同设备上具有良好的响应式表现。
- 界面优化:优化界面布局和交互,提高用户操作的便捷性。
五、总结
从React升级版本到优化用户体验是一个复杂的过程,但只要遵循以上步骤,相信您能够轻松应对新版本挑战,提升用户满意度与操作流畅度。希望本文对您有所帮助。
